Britain Pays For Stupidity Over Research

(N.7. P.A.-

- Reuter .

Covyright)

Received Tuesdav, 7 p.m. LONDON, August 30. Professor 7-1 r nest Chain who shared the Nobel Pri 7.0 for the discoyerv of penicillin with Sir Alexander Fleming and Rir Howard Florov, has given up research work in Britain and aeeopted an appointment to the chair of chemistrv at Rome University. The News Chronicle says Professor Ohaiu has left Britain because the Ttalians have agreed to provide liim with facilitios for further research into micro-u-ganisms and moulds wliich might • iiave properties akin to penicillin. ITe endeavoured without success to obtaia similar facilities in Britain. The News Chronicle points out that Britain, whose scientisfs discovered penicillin, is now paying high royalties to Amerieans for the use of technical processes necessarv for its manufaeture, all because Britain refused to patent tliese' procesess when the drug was first discovered. Britain is also paying lurgs sums for streptomycin, another crug which was discovered as the resc.lt of research which extended the, nork done 011 penicillin. The Chronicle fontends that in the field of commercial dev-elopnient of antibiotics, Britain is being left behind as she was in the' la«»t century when she lost the commer | cial development of aniline dyes to tlie Gennans. j j
